On my way

Wednesday, 24.09.2008

ATI ja Linux sopii yhdessä - jättää myymälään ostamatta…

Filed under: Computers, Gadgets, Tips — admin @ 18:08

Ei sitä vain koskaan opi. Muistutan heti alkuunsa että älä osta ATI näytönohjainta!

Tuli aikanaan ostettua tietokone osista ja oli tarkoitus kasata siitä hyvä kokoonpano. Hyvät komponentit tuli valittua ja sitten laittamaan yhteen. Kasaus onnistui ilman mitään ongelmia. Mutta kone ei herännyt henkiin. No - hieman tarkastuksia ja… ei edelleenkään. Seuraavaksi muistien vaihto eri paikkoihin - eikä eloa. No - muistit takaisin kauppaan ja toiset halvemmat (hitaammat) tilalle. Ja ei sittenkään eloa. Prkl… projekti sai jäädä sitten jäihin kunnes taas jaksaa.

Myöhemmin huomasin kokeilla ikivanhaa PCI väyläistä näytönohjainta ja sillä kone saikin eloa?!?! Mikä vika Nvidia ohjaimessa oli? No - näytönohjain meni sitten toiseen koneeseen ja siellä se toimi hyvin. Vaikka näytönohjain olikin “liian hyvä” siihen. Myöhemmin ostin sitten ATI näytönohjaimen tähän emolevyyn ja kaikki oli about kunnossa kun käyttää Linuxin open-source ajureita. Mutta aina välillä tulee halu saada testattua Linuxin pelejä 3D kiihdytyksellä, kiihtyykin vain ylläpitäjän mieli… ATI:n fglrx -ajurit on PASKAT. ATI ei osaa tehdä ajureita joissa toimisi sekä videoiden pyöritys että 3D kiihdytys. Ja vielä työpöytäefektitkin… Jätä siis ATI ohjain ostamatta!

Linuxia ei tarvi boottailla. Paitsi jos siinä on fglrx ajurit. Ja haluat katsoa välillä videoita ja välillä pelata. Silloin joudut boottailemaan AINA kun haluat vaihtaa ominaisuudesta toiseen. Seuraavassa ohjeet kuinka vaihdat ATI näytönohjainta Xv ja opengl -tilan välillä:

  • aticonfig –initial  –ovt opengl
  • aticonfig –initial  –ovt Xv

Noilla käskyillä aktivoidaan jompi kumpi tila sekä “unohdetaan” aikaisempi xorg.conf konfiguraatio. Ja aina muutoksen jälkeen tietokone on käynnistettävä uudelleen. Perinteisesti olin tottunut että grafiikkatila vain uudelleenkäynnistetään (esim. painamalla ctrl-alt-backspace). Mutta ATI:n fglrx -ajurien kanssa se ei riitä. Eli, “Linuxia ei tarvi bootata” -totuus on sitten ATI:n rikkoma. Tällaista se on kun kaupalliset (ja suljetut softat) tahot pääsee vaikuttamaan asioihin.
Paras näytönohjain tuntuu olevan Intelin piireillä olevat. Siinä toimii Linuxin työpöytäefektit, videoiden katsominen ja ilmeisesti myös 3D pelit. Ja ajurit on avoimeen lähdekoodiin perustuvat.

Nvidia tekee pitälti ATI:n tavoin suljettuun ohjelmistoon perustuvaa Linux ajuria. Mutta siinä sentään toimii kaikki kolme asiaa yhtäaikaa: videot, 3D ja työpöytäefektit. Eli - jätä ATI ostamatta. Ja emolevyt missä ei toimi muut näytönohjaimet.

Sunday, 17.08.2008

Windowsin käyttö Linuxin KVM:ssä - näppäimistöongelma

Filed under: Computers, Tips — admin @ 14:22

Olen käyttänyt KVM virtualisointia pääasiallisena Windowsin ajamiseen. KVM toimii hyvin, siinä ei ole tullut mitään Windowsin sekoiluja (niin hyvin kuin Windows voi vain toimia ;). Mutta KVM:ssä on muutamia puutteita verrattuna Vmwareen ja VirtualBoxiin.
Windosia käyttäessä näppäimistö ei toimi täydellisesti. Käytän KVM:ssä oletusnäppäimistöasetuksia. Mutta kun painan esimerkiksi näppäintä “<”, en saa sitä ulos. Samoin myös heittomerkki ja tähti ei tule ulos

Tähän ongelmaan löysin apua ohjelmasta nimeltään Synergy. Asensin client -ohjelman Windowsille ja host Linuxille. Synergyllä voidaan jakaa yksi näppäimistö ja hiiri usealle tietokoneelle. Siirrät vain hiiren kuvaruudun johonkin reunaan, se ilmestyy toisen tietokoneen ruudulle. Ja näppäimistö ja hiiri toimii siinä koneessa sitten täydellisesti. Tässä KVM tapauksessa virtuaalikone ja fyysinen kone on samalla näytöllä, joten hiiri hyppääkin virtuaalikoneen ruutuun. Lisäksi Synergy osaa siirtää myös leikepöydän sisällön!

Näppäimistöä ja hiirtä jakavassa koneessa käynnistetään synergys -ohjelma ja Windowsissa Synergy konfiguroidaan ottamaan yhteyttä isäntäkoneen IP osoitteeseen. Eli käytössä täytyy olla NATtattu verkkoyhteys, jolloin isäntäkoneen IP on kiinteä.

Powered by WordPress